      1 // RUN: %clang_cc1 -fsyntax-only -verify %s
      2 
      3 typedef double * __attribute__((align_value(64))) aligned_double;
      4 
      5 void foo(aligned_double x, double * y __attribute__((align_value(32)))) { };
      6 
      7 // expected-error@+1 {{requested alignment is not a power of 2}}
      8 typedef double * __attribute__((align_value(63))) aligned_double1;
      9 
     10 // expected-error@+1 {{requested alignment is not a power of 2}}
     11 typedef double * __attribute__((align_value(-2))) aligned_double2;
     12 
     13 // expected-error@+1 {{attribute takes one argument}}
     14 typedef double * __attribute__((align_value(63, 4))) aligned_double3;
     15 
     16 // expected-error@+1 {{attribute takes one argument}}
     17 typedef double * __attribute__((align_value())) aligned_double3a;
     18 
     19 // expected-error@+1 {{attribute takes one argument}}
     20 typedef double * __attribute__((align_value)) aligned_double3b;
     21 
     22 // expected-error@+1 {{'align_value' attribute requires integer constant}}
     23 typedef double * __attribute__((align_value(4.5))) aligned_double4;
     24 
     25 // expected-warning@+1 {{'align_value' attribute only applies to a pointer or reference ('int' is invalid)}}
     26 typedef int __attribute__((align_value(32))) aligned_int;
     27 
     28 typedef double * __attribute__((align_value(32*2))) aligned_double5;
     29 
     30 // expected-warning@+1 {{'align_value' attribute only applies to variables and typedefs}}
     31 void foo() __attribute__((align_value(32)));
